The overview below groups typical Wood Cladding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Charlestown,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of wood cladding materials can vary from approximately $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of wood selected. Higher-end hardwoods may increase overall expenses for larger projects.
Installation Expenses - Labor costs for installing wood cladding typically range from $4 to $12 per square foot. Factors influencing price include project complexity and local labor rates.
Total Project Cost - Overall costs for wood cladding installation can range from $7 to $22 per square foot, combining materials and labor. Larger or more intricate projects tend to be on the higher end of this spectrum.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include surface preparation, finishing, and sealing,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These services enhance durability and appearance but increase the total expense.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
